网工干货知识

超全学习笔记
当前位置:首页 > 干货知识

什么是APPN(高级点对点网络技术)?

更新时间:2026年03月27日   作者:spoto   标签(Tag):

高级点对点网络技术(APPN)它是 IBM 系统网络架构的一部分。这种协议允许一组计算机之间相互通信,而不需要依赖中央服务器或任何其他硬件设备来协调它们之间的通信。

点对点网络的需求

万维网的出现带来了一个新的问题。当时,可用的节点数量不足以支持那些基于网络的应用程序的运行,因为网络上的流量持续增加。这就导致了客户端-服务器模式下网络带宽的短缺。点对点式后来开发的系统提供了一种解决方案:系统中的每个节点都可以同时充当客户端和服务器角色,从而为各种域应用程序提供所需的资源。这些应用程序可以共享系统中可用的各种资源。 因此,在纯粹的点对点网络系统中,不存在集中的协调机制。因为各个参与节点都拥有自主权,所以它们能够自行组织系统的结构。 因此,这种点对点网络能够解决传统客户端-服务器系统所面临的许多问题。不过,它也有自己的缺点,我们将在后面详细讨论这些缺点。

APPN的历史

系统网络架构(SNA)是IBM的这种网络架构是在1974年开发的,其目的是作为大型计算机之间进行通信的手段。 它拥有多种接口,使得软件和硬件能够相互通信。 由于它的响应具有可预测性且非常稳定,因此被广泛应用于各种场合中。 不过,其无法在SNA资源之间建立动态连接,以及当软件或硬件在传输过程中出现故障时对最终用户会话产生的影响,都是该系统的重大缺陷。 因此,APPN已经发展出了一种系统,其节点能够理解并解析网络拓扑结构。这些节点能够识别本地网络中各个节点的位置,同时还能利用当前及相邻的网络来寻找资源。 因此,APPN能够识别并选择会话伙伴之间的最佳路径。

APPN的工作原理

  • 由于目录服务是分布式的,因此每个节点只需要记住那些使用其服务的资源即可。不过,通过使用VTAM技术,目录服务可以被集中化处理。
  • 它能够动态地定位并定义各种资源,同时能够将在网络中的任意两个逻辑单元之间建立连接。因此,无需使用大型机来实现这一功能。
  • 正如我们之前所看到的,APPN具有理解并解析网络拓扑结构的能力,因此能够确定会话伙伴之间的最佳路径。如果网络发生任何变化,那么网络拓扑结构也会相应地得到更新。
  • 在APPN中,服务等级实际上可以扩展到网络中的各个终端节点,而不仅仅是像传统客户端-服务器系统那样仅限于前端处理器的范围内。此外,APPN还允许定义成本以及其他重要特性。

APPN节点的作用及其运作机制

APPN由多个T2.1节点组成,这些节点之间相互连接。它们通过APPC协议来实现逻辑单元之间的通信以及同级节点间的连接。它们负责执行以下任务:

  • 他们所拥有的资源位置信息会在它们之间进行动态交换。
  • 它记录了网络中各个SNA资源的位置信息。
  • 因为它能够理解并解析网络拓扑结构,因此它能够选择会话伙伴之间最理想的传输路径。

T2.1节点的类型

  • 低接入点网络(LEN)
  • APPN端节点EN)
  • APPN网络节点(NN)
  • 专门的VTAM节点

APPN的优势

  • 动态定义可用的网络资源,从而简化连接、路由以及重新配置的过程。
  • 资源注册和目录查询的自动化处理
  • 灵活性使得APPN能够适用于各种网络拓扑结构。
  • 设置起来比较简单,因此可以节省配置和实施的時間。
  • 能够隔离终端故障。
  • 它具有成本效益。
  • 在点对点网络中,所有的节点既充当服务器角色,也充当客户端角色。因此,不需要专门的或集中的服务器。与传统的客户端-服务器网络不同,后者如果中央服务器出现故障,整个系统就会陷入瘫痪。而在这里则不会出现这种情况。
  • 由于在一个点对点网络中,每个客户端都充当着服务器的角色,因此当更多的客户端加入该网络时,网络的性能会得到提升。这与传统的客户端-服务器模型不同,在传统的模型中,这种情况并不会发生。

APPN的缺点

  • 文件和文件夹无法被集中备份。
  • 随着每台计算机可以被多个用户访问,用户的操作速度可能会受到一定的影响。
  • 由于文件和资源都存储在各自的计算机上,因此它们无法被集中管理。因此,要找到这些文件和资源可能会比较困难。
  • 由于用户通常不需要登录到他们的工作站上,因此除了权限问题之外,几乎不存在其他安全问题。
  • 必须采取措施来防止病毒攻击,否则,各个用户都将不得不承担因这些攻击而造成的损失。
              马上抢免费试听资格
意向课程:*必选
姓名:*必填
联系方式:*必填
QQ:
思博SPOTO在线咨询

相关资讯

即刻预约

免费试听-咨询课程-获取免费资料